About Lane Green First School
Ofsted's Parent View responses for Lane Green First School, collected between September 2024 and September 2025, show that 63% of the 27 parents who responded would recommend the school to other families. That's a solid majority, though it's worth noting that 37% said they would not. Looking at the detail, there are some real bright spots: 89% of parents either agreed or strongly agreed that their child is happy, and 92% felt their child is safe. Behaviour is seen positively too, with 97% agreeing the school ensures good conduct. However, the picture is more mixed on communication and support. Only 44% agreed that concerns are dealt with properly, and a quarter disagreed or strongly disagreed. On SEND support, the question drew no responses at all, which may reflect a small number of families with children on the SEND register. The school is clearly popular locally: for 2025/26 admissions, it received 60 applications for just 29 places, an oversubscription ratio of 2.07, and 27 of the 28 first-preference families were offered a spot.
